Background
Warner River Produce has evolved from being a USDA certified organic producer to maintaining high organic standards without the certification. Known for its diverse offerings, the farm operates year-round in Webster and Henniker, and seasonally at St Pauls School and Hopkinton. The farm has built a reputation for its wide range of products including vegetables, herbs, mushrooms, honey, and eggs.
Practices
Warner River Produce adheres to farming practices that meet or exceed USDA organic standards, despite no longer holding the certification. The farm emphasizes the importance of quality and sustainability in its production of seasonal mixed vegetables, culinary and medicinal herbs, ginger, turmeric, raw honey, Shiitake mushrooms, tree fruit, rhubarb, chicken and duck eggs, and berries. Their commitment to these practices ensures that their produce is grown with care for both the land and the consumer.
The Rest
Warner River Produce offers a 52-week Farmers Market style CSA/pay ahead option, bulk purchases in summer and fall, seed garlic, and educational workshops. They participate in various summer farmers markets including Canterbury, Contoocook, Franklin, Penacook, and St Paul's School in Concord, and operate a farm stand on Jewett Rd in Hopkinton. In winter, they can be found at the Concord Indoor Winter Farmers Market at Eagle Square, as well as markets in Contoocook, Canterbury, Danbury, and Penacook. Customers can also order plants, produce, and other products online and select a pickup location or delivery.
